    I was on the USS Newport LST-1179 for this operation

    Quote Originally Posted by tracs2142 View Post
    USS Ponce, LPD-15, 1980 for Anorak Express to Norway. We took almost 2 weeks crossing the Atlantic in winter..oh what fun. We loaded stores/ammo at Norfolk expecting we were going to Iran, rather than war games. Of course, Jimmy Carter would never allow it.

    When I stood well-deck watch, you could look out the upper half of the rear opening of the ship. One moment was stars, next black ocean. As bad as it was, I felt sorry for the poor guys on the LST!

    Other than cramped quarters, it was a good time mostly. Did not like being locked in quarters during drills.
    I was on the USS Newport fot this operation, You're right, Cold, rough seas, but I had a blast. I wouldn't trade it for anything. I've attached a couple picture. One is the USS Ponce from the stern. I was on the landing craft as we were entering through her stern gate. The others were taken about a second apart. Notice the roll of the ship. Sea and Sky. This was taken on the way to Plymouth England on the way back from Norway.

    USS Newport LST-1179 on Anorak Express

    Here's a few pics from the Newport and of Norway. Loading Trucks on, a view out the open stern ramp from the tank deck (the ramp got bent and we had to secure it to a bulldozer on the way to Portsmouth Eng. for repairs), loading fuel pods in Norway, me and my M-54 5ton (I had 2 500 gal pods of JP5 and one of AVgas, I slept one night in the cab and had a parachute flare come down in the back and didn't know it, I **** myself in the morning when I found it laying between two of the pods), Never give Engineers white camo.
